Research Interest:
Photogalvanic effect was investigated using reductant EDTA-LGB-XCFF system.Investigated photogalvanic system can be used for 54 minutes in dark at its power point, effect of various parameter on electrical output of the photo galvanic cell was studied ,fill factor and conversion efficiency.Fill factor and conversion efficiency of the investigated system calculated as 0.40 and 0.83 % respectively. On the basis electroactive species and investigated EDTA-LGB-XCFF system a mechanism of generation of current has also been proposed with Green & Sustainable renewable energy.
